I followed the below steps to set up a workspace for go in ubuntu 16.

1.Downloaded go 1.14 version for linux from https://golang.org/

2.Extracted it in the /usr/local using the command-

sudo tar -C /usr/local -xzf go1.14.4.linux-amd64.tar.gz

3.Added path in the .profile by adding the line

PATH="$PATH:/usr/local/go/bin"

4.Sourced this in the session with command -

source ~/.profile

5.Checked go version

But the terminal returns the error

The program 'go' is currently not installed. You can install it by typing: sudo apt install golang-go

Can anyone please explain where I am going wrong with this ?
